Joe Gordon might be gone, but his family still remains at K-State in the form of incoming freshman wide receiver LeAndrew Gordon, who likely committed because his father still was a recruiting coordinator here at the time.

But despite his father's absence (Joe's now an assistant coach at Garden City Community College with Matt Miller and Jeff Kelly), Gordon stayed committed and is on track to be here for fall practice. Watch his highlights here.

He's very small, so I expect a redshirt season, but he's also apparently very fast, so we can't rule anything out.

Tyler Lockett played as a true freshman, after all, and while I'm not suggesting Gordon is anywhere near that talented, Bill Snyder has shown that he is willing to put speed on the field at any age.

Gordon helped Pantego Christian Academy to a 6-4 record and a district championship during his senior year.

He was listed as the fastest wide receiver in the class of 2013, according to ESPNU, and was a first-team all-district selection following his junior year. Gordon also was a standout for the Panthers basketball and track teams.
